GoodTilDate
GoodTilDate is a financial term used predominantly in trading and investment contexts to specify the expiration date of an order, contract, or option. It indicates the date until which the order remains valid and active in the market. If the order is not executed by this date, it automatically expires, preventing unintended executions or outdated trades.
